Transaction 38f59043d2812816d1b6405e98cad17b0d4e04da8f331005fa560c77446983b1
1 Input
1 Output
-
38f59043d2812816d1b6405e98cad17b0d4e04da8f331005fa560c77446983b1:0
- value
- 5737504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 972cec51e67a95cfe02913291fb31cb9372cd0ed OP_EQUAL
- address
- 3FUMmpikMnHu8KfudVU7MBP2Bg67BRqCdi